| Line item | Three Months Ended September 30, 2025 | Three Months Ended September 30, 2024 | Nine Months Ended September 30, 2025 | Nine Months Ended September 30, 2024 |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Natural gas transportation service revenues | $750 | $663 | $2,134 | $1,949 |
| Natural gas storage service revenues | 51 | 52 | 169 | 148 |
| Natural gas product sales | 37 | 26 | 81 | 72 |
| Other service revenues | 6 | 5 | 21 | 19 |
| Total revenues | 844 | 746 | 2,405 | 2,188 |
| Costs and expenses: | ||||
| Natural gas product costs | 37 | 26 | 81 | 72 |
| Operating and maintenance expenses | 131 | 138 | 372 | 376 |

- What does product and service other — revenue mean?
- This metric represents the revenue generated from ancillary products and services that fall outside of the company's primary midstream energy transportation and storage operations. It typically includes income from specialized technical services, equipment leasing, or secondary product sales that leverage existing infrastructure assets. This revenue stream provides diversification to the core pipeline business and reflects the company's ability to monetize non-core operational capabilities.
